1146 - Nature Preserved Journal

$ 120 Plus $15 materials fee  

 

Construct an innovative journal to showcase and protect delicate treasures from nature. This workshop combines bookbinding, and exploring techniques to transform live botanicals into cherished keepsakes, along with discussing ways to incorporate natural elements into pieces of art.

Using the front and back panels of a book, you will learn a fast and easy way of turning plain ordinary
covers into a work of art. It will be something you will want to proudly use over and over for gathering
flora and fauna. Inside this journal, will be pocket pages to fill with fresh natural elements from
delicate bouquets of Virginia flowers. You will learn a unique method for instantly preserving the elegant beauty of the items, along with traditional methods of pressing botanicals. Finally, composing from gathered quotes, photos, field notes, and memories will be pages about nature that are sentimental, heart-felt, and personal.

Supply List:
--book cover can be vintage or new- must be in good condition - we will be separating front and back (the front cover should measure close to 7.25" x 10.25 - definitely not smaller,  a little bigger is ok)
--1 yd. of Lite Steam-A-Seam2 (can be found at any fine fabric store)
--1/4 yd. cotton print fabric ( to coordinate with your book cover)
--1/2 yd. of white muslin
--1 yd. of very see-thru sheer fabric or tulle - ok to have glitter or sparkles as part of the fabric (can be
found at fine fabric stores)
--2 yds of 1" wide satin ribbon ( to coordinate with your book cover)
--Metal Ruler with cork or non-slip backing
--Sharpie Fine Point Marker
--two (PS-4) scrapbook screw posts and extensions ( can be found at Michaels Crafts)
--small pair of sharp scissors to cut fabric and a pair to cut paper
--Goldens Matte Gel Heavy and cheap 1/2" flat brush for applying Matte Gel (found at Michael's Crafts or www.dickblick.com)
--1 piece of sturdy cardboard 3.25" x 5.25" cut to size

Materials fee includes:
Fresh Flowers, Botanicals, and Leaves
20 - 9" x 6.75" Glassine Envelopes
20 - 9" x 1" binding strips for envelopes
3 large sheets of blank Newsprint paper
